大数据决策树是一种基于机器学习的数据分析技术,它通过构建决策树模型来预测和分类数据。下面是一个关于大数据决策树的例题分析与应用。
例题:假设我们有一个数据集,包含用户的年龄、性别、收入和消费习惯等特征,以及他们的购买行为(是否购买新产品)。我们希望预测用户是否会购买新产品。我们可以使用大数据决策树来解决这个问题。
首先,我们需要对数据集进行预处理,包括特征选择、缺失值处理和异常值处理等。然后,我们将使用随机森林算法(Random Forest)来构建决策树模型。
在构建决策树的过程中,我们会不断地将数据分为训练集和测试集,直到达到某个预设的精度要求。每次划分数据时,我们会选择一个特征作为分割条件,并计算每个子集的类别计数。然后,我们会根据类别计数的大小来调整分裂阈值,使得每个子集中的类别数尽量接近。
在训练过程中,我们还会计算每个节点的Gini系数,以评估模型的性能。当一个节点的Gini系数小于某个阈值时,我们就认为这个节点可以停止分裂,并开始构建叶子节点。
最后,我们将所有的叶子节点连接起来,就得到了最终的决策树模型。这个模型可以用来预测用户是否会购买新产品。例如,如果一个用户的年龄大于30岁且收入较高,那么他们购买新产品的可能性就会比年龄较小或收入较低的用户更高。
大数据决策树的应用非常广泛。在商业领域,它可以帮助企业发现潜在客户,优化市场策略;在医疗领域,它可以辅助医生进行疾病诊断和治疗方案的选择;在金融领域,它可以用于信用评估和风险控制;在政府领域,它可以用于城市规划和资源分配等。总之,大数据决策树是一种非常有潜力的数据分析工具。